Description
Julie Shannon. Environmentally preferable purchasing ensures that environmental considerations are included in purchasing decisions, along with traditional factors such as product price & performance. This report by the EPA provides an overview of recent state & local government environmentally preferable purchasing (EPP) initiatives & includes references to specific products & technologies. EPP strategies include: cooperative efforts, price preferences, best value purchasing, green teams, vendor fairs, third-party certifiers, incentive programs, employee training, & vendor surveys. The product evaluation chapter covers: computers, green power, vehicles, paint, & much more.
